How the effect works in simple terms
Traditionally, rotoscoping meant tracing over video frame by frame. With modern AI, the app can detect the subject, follow movement, interpret edges, and apply a drawn or animated treatment automatically. Instead of manually tracing each frame, creators can guide the look with prompts, reference visuals, or style choices.
The basic technical workflow
- Subject detection identifies the person or object that should stay prominent.
- Motion tracking follows body movement across frames.
- Edge interpretation helps the system preserve silhouette and action.
- Style rendering applies an illustrated, sketch-like, or painted motion look.
- Frame smoothing keeps the final result from flickering too much between moments.

How to get better results fast
Start with the right footage
- Use clips with a clear subject and minimal background clutter.
- Keep movement readable. Big, intentional motion works better than tiny gestures.
- Shoot with decent lighting so the AI can separate the subject more reliably.
- Avoid shaky footage unless the chaos is part of your style.
Match the effect to the sound
This effect works best when the visual motion hits the beat. Trim your source clip so the strongest movement lands early. On TikTok and Instagram, the first second matters most.

Even highly stylized AI effects need responsible use. If your clip includes another person, get their permission before transforming or posting it. Be extra careful with recognizable faces, client work, and branded content. Avoid misleading viewers if the animation implies something that never happened.
- Get consent before stylizing other people in promotional content.
- Disclose AI use when relevant, especially for brand or client campaigns.
- Avoid using AI effects to create misleading performance claims or fake event footage.
- Test exports on-platform to make sure compression does not ruin the look.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is an AI rotoscope effect?
It is an AI-generated video style that transforms real footage into animation-like frames by tracking motion and applying a drawn or stylized look.
Is the AI rotoscope effect good for TikTok?
Yes. It works well for TikTok when your clip has strong movement, a clear subject, and a fast visual hook in the first second.
Can I make rotoscope-style videos from existing footage?
Yes. Many AI video tools let you upload existing clips and apply stylized motion treatments instead of filming from scratch.
How do I get smoother rotoscope-style results?
Use clean footage, readable movement, stable framing, and a clear subject so the AI can track motion more consistently.
